Key Features of the Hisense U8H ULED

  • Quantum Dot Technology: Delivers vibrant colors and sharp images, enhancing the cinematic experience.
  • Mini-LED Backlighting: Provides excellent contrast and deep blacks, ideal for dark scenes in movies.
  • 4K Resolution: Ensures crisp, detailed images suitable for high-definition content.
  • High Dynamic Range (HDR): Supports Dolby Vision and HDR10+ for richer colors and better contrast.
  • Fast Response Time: Reduces motion blur, making fast-paced action scenes smoother.

Pros and Cons

  • Pros:
    • Excellent picture quality for the price
    • Strong contrast and vibrant colors
    • Supports multiple HDR formats
    • Good motion handling
  • Cons:
    • Sound quality could be improved
    • Limited viewing angles compared to OLEDs
    • Some users report minor software bugs
